How they compare
Bulgaria currently reports 1.67 against 1.45 in Kiribati, a difference of 0.22.
That makes Bulgaria's figure about 1.2 times Kiribati's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 40 shared years of data; in 1987 it was Kiribati ahead.
Bulgaria ranks 158th and Kiribati ranks 161st of 181 countries.
Across the 5 decades both report, Bulgaria averaged higher in 3 and Kiribati in 2.

About this data
Local currency units (LCU) per U.S. dollar, with values after a new currency's introduction presented in the old currency's terms
